SDG-Aligned Research Themes

International Conference on Teacher Preparation for Special Education conference tracks support global knowledge exchange, innovation, and sustainable development priorities across diverse disciplines.

SDG 4 - Quality Education SDG 8 - Decent Work and Economic Growth SDG 9 - Industry, Innovation and Infrastructure SDG 10 - Reduced Inequalities

This track explores cutting-edge teaching methodologies tailored for special education settings. Participants will discuss the impact of innovative pedagogies on student engagement and learning outcomes.

This session focuses on the design and implementation of inclusive curricula that address the needs of students with disabilities. Attendees will share best practices and strategies for fostering accessibility in educational content.

This track examines effective assessment tools and evaluation methods for measuring student progress in special education. Discussions will include the role of formative and summative assessments in promoting equitable learning opportunities.

This session highlights the importance of leadership in shaping teacher preparation programs for special education. Participants will explore strategies for cultivating leadership skills among educators to enhance program effectiveness.

This track invites contributions that showcase international approaches to teacher preparation in special education. Participants will analyze how cultural contexts influence inclusive practices and educational policies.

This session emphasizes the critical role of collaboration between teachers and families in supporting students with disabilities. Participants will discuss strategies for building effective partnerships that enhance student learning.

This track focuses on the integration of sustainability principles within special education teacher preparation. Attendees will explore how sustainable practices can improve educational outcomes and resource management.

This session addresses the challenges and solutions related to equitable access to resources for students with disabilities. Participants will discuss policies and practices that promote fairness in educational opportunities.

This track highlights the importance of ongoing professional development in enhancing the skills of special education teachers. Participants will share effective models and frameworks for continuous learning and growth.

This session explores strategies for implementing inclusive practices within classroom instruction. Participants will discuss techniques that support diverse learners and promote an inclusive educational environment.

This track invites researchers to share their findings on current trends and innovations in special education teacher preparation. Discussions will focus on evidence-based practices that inform future educational policies and programs.
